Changes in prescribing antithrombotic therapy in patients with atrial fibrillation and myocardial infarction in 2016-2019
Aim. To study the changes in prescribing antithrombotic therapy (ATT) among patients with myocardial infarction (MI) and atrial fibrillation (AF), hospitalized in a cardiology hospital in 2016-2017 and 2018-2019.Material and methods.
